Is there a difference between an electrician and an electrical contractor?

An electrician is the skilled tradesperson who performs the hands-on installation and repair of electrical systems. An electrical contractor manages projects, handles permits, and supervises the work. Both are crucial for safe and compliant electrical services in the District of Columbia.

What are the four types of electricians?

The four common types are residential, commercial, industrial, and low-voltage electricians. Residential electricians work on homes, while commercial electricians focus on businesses. Industrial electricians handle large-scale facilities, and low-voltage electricians specialize in systems like data and security.

How much does it cost to have electric service installed?

The price to install new electric service is determined by the required amperage, the distance from the utility source, and any necessary groundwork like trenching.
